WebThe example shows how to pass functions as props to a React component using TypeScript. The sum function takes 2 parameters of type number and returns a number. … WebFeb 22, 2024 · PropTypes P ropTypes are a mechanism to ensure that components use the correct data type and pass the right data, and that components use the right type of props, and that receiving...
Function Components React TypeScript Cheatsheets
WebNov 24, 2024 · TypeScript’s Definitely Typed library include the React.FunctionComponent (or React.FC for short) that you can use to type React function components. You can combine the type Props and the React.FC type to create a type-safe function component with props as follows: type Props = { title: string } const App: React.FC = ( {title}) … WebApr 8, 2024 · export function ToDoItem (props: { toDo: ToDo; onDeleteToDo: any; onUpdateTodo: any; }) { const handleOptionsChange = (event: any) => { const selectBox = event.target; const newValue = selectBox.value; const newPriority = parseInt (newValue); props.onUpdateTodo ( { priority: newPriority }) }; const checkBoxCheck = (event: any) => { … propeller for tohatsu outboard motor
React HoC в TypeScript. Типизация без боли / Хабр
WebSep 29, 2024 · Typing a React component is usually a 2 steps process. A) Define the interface that describes what props the component accepts using an object type. A good naming convention for the props interface is ComponentName + Props = ComponentNameProps B) Then use the interface to annotate the props parameter inside … WebApr 11, 2024 · Update React Components Define the type of props and state using interfaces or types: Interfaces or types can be used to define the shape of props and state objects in a React component. Here's an example of an interface for props: interface Props { name: string; age: number; isMale: boolean; } Here's an example of an interface for state: WebJul 3, 2024 · In the code above, is a Class Component and in TypeScript, React.Component is defined as a generic type with two optional type parameters. The first one is for prop type and the second for the state type. QuoteProps is the type defined for the props allowed in the component. lactose is a protein